About Dennis Connolly

Dennis Connolly is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Infectious Diseases, having authored 7 papers that have together received 498 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Natural Language Processing Techniques (3 papers), Topic Modeling (3 papers) and Neural Networks and Applications (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Artificial Intelligence (476 citations), Management Science and Operations Research (36 citations) and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(30 citations). Dennis Connolly has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include John D. Burger, John Aberdeen, Marc Vilain and Lynette Hirschman.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of SPIE, the International Society for Optical Engineering/Proceedings of SPIE.
